How to fill out PDF 0 bytes?

01
Check the file size: Before attempting to fill out a PDF file and encountering 0 bytes, make sure to check the file size. A PDF file size of 0 bytes usually indicates an empty or corrupted file.
02
Verify file extension: Ensure that the file has the correct extension (.pdf). If the extension is incorrect, rename the file and add the .pdf extension.
03
Try opening the file: Double-click the PDF file to open it. If it opens successfully, it may not be a 0-byte file, and you can proceed with filling it out as needed.
04
Use a reliable PDF editor: If the PDF file still appears to be 0 bytes and cannot be opened, use a reliable PDF editor software. There are numerous options available online that can repair damaged or corrupted PDF files.
05
Repair the PDF file: Open the PDF editor, and look for an option to repair or restore damaged files. Follow the software's instructions to repair the 0-byte PDF file.
06
Fill out the PDF file: Once the PDF file is repaired, you can begin filling it out as necessary. Utilize the available tools in the PDF editor software to insert text, add checkboxes, or create fillable forms.
07
Save and test the file: After filling out the PDF, save it and ensure that the file size is no longer 0 bytes. Try reopening the PDF to verify that the information you entered is intact and accessible.
